Mar-16-11 | | TheFocus: Originally, 1.d4 e6 2.c4 Bb4+ was known as the Keres Defense (also Franco-Indian Defense). Never heard it called the Kangaroo Defense. |

 | | Fusilli: What's the problem with 32.Nxe5? |
|
Mar-19-11
 | | tpstar: 32. Nxe5?! a6:
 click for larger viewBlack wins the exchange after 33. Nxd3 axb5, or White could try 33. Nc4 axb5 34. Nxd6 bxa4 which looks very good for Black. |
